What to know about Bosphorus

The Bosphorus Strait in Istanbul, Turkey, is a mesmerizing natural waterway that captivates travelers with its unique blend of natural beauty, historical significance, and cultural richness. As the world's narrowest strait used for international navigation, it connects the Black Sea to the Sea of Marmara, forming a continental boundary between Asia and Europe. This enchanting strait not only divides Turkey geographically but also unites it through its vibrant cultural tapestry. Cultural and Historical Significance

The Bosphorus is a captivating waterway that has played a crucial role throughout history, serving as a strategic point for empires like the Byzantines and Ottomans. As you explore its shores, you'll encounter palaces, fortresses, and historic mansions that narrate the rich past of Istanbul. This iconic strait not only bridges Europe and Asia but also stands as a testament to the city's vibrant heritage, having witnessed countless historical events and serving as a vital trade route and military point.
